Packaging steel strip electrolytic cleaning principle is what? When connect the cathode and anode steel strip by electrolytic cell, steel strip as electrolytic cell of the positive or negative. In electrolysis process, the steel strip surface will be a small hydrogen or oxygen generation, these tiny bubbles have promote the dirt cleaned from the stripped from the surface of a steel band. In electrolytic degreasing sodium hydroxide, sodium carbonate is used in alkaline aqueous solution, such as the existence of alkali electrolyte ion, increased the water conductive ability, also played a promoting role to eliminate the dirt. Because lye to lipid oily dirt strong dispersion effect. But such as sodium hydroxide alkaline substances such as mineral oil with people about dirt dispersion ability is weak, so want to add people to the solution of sodium metasilicate and a small amount of surfactant, and mineral oil dirt dispersion. When caitu substrate is zinc or aluminium plate, due to the alkali resistance is poor, weak base such as sodium silicate as electrolyte, sodium metasilicate alkali corrosion resistance of nonferrous metals has obvious improvement action. When aluminum anodized relief wax ( That need to be metal degreasing aluminum electrolytic cell with the power connected to the anode, in the process of electrolytic aluminum as anode in aluminum anode golden field surface will precipitate anhydrous silica gel covering membrane, protect the aluminum corrosion is shout. When the foaming properties of surfactants are excessive to skim obstruction, to use low foaming surfactant or day to feed the surfactant dosage. Electrolytic degreasing method according to be skimmed substrate as electrode is divided into anode and cathode degreasing degreasing. The degreasing substrates are connected to the power supply cathode called cathode skim. Due to the electrolytic process, the hydrogen gas is generated in a cathode anode produce oxygen twice, so the cathode produce hydrogen for the dirt on the surface of the substrate stripping effect is better. But if the deal with excessive, in cleaning object namely steel strip surface can form the powdery material, to be pickled post-processing to remove these materials at this time. Another when steel cathode electrode skim also produces hydrogen can cause the nature of the brittle, and absorbed the phenomenon known as the hydrogen embrittlement. Hydrogen embrittlement in all kinds of high, low carbon steel and metal zinc is the most obvious. And brittleness is proportional to the amount of hydrogen absorption. So steel substrate usually use anode more without the cathode electrolytic degreasing degreasing.
